Yann Arthus Bertrand: Home – Gabon

Yann Arthus-Bertrand and his team travelled around the planet over 18 months to make this film. This movie shot from the air over fifty countries – including GABON – has a mission and carries a message for humanity : to become aware of the full extent of its spoliation of the Earth’s riches and change its patterns of consumption.
